Marinated Cucumbers 

4 to 6 servings

This simple condiment from Thailand provides a cooling counterpart to a spicy entree such as Singapore Satay.

  • 1/3 cup white vinegar
  • 1/4 cup water
  • 1/4 cup sugar
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1 large cucumber
  • 1/4 cup roasted peanuts, chopped
  •    some sliced bermuda onion

In a small pan, combine vinegar, water, sugar and salt. Cook over medium heat, stirring, until liquid boils and sugar is dissolved; remove from heat and let cool to room temperature.

Peel cucumber; cut lengthwise, scoop out and discard seeds, slice cucumber into 1/8-inch slices. Place in serving bowls, pour marinade over cucumbers; stir to blend. If made ahead, cover and refrigerate for UP TO 2 HOURS (does not keep well after that).

Top with Peanuts or slices of bermuda onion if desired.

 
Nutrition Facts
Amount Per Serving: Calories 60 - Calories from Fat 0
Percent Total Calories From: Fat 1%, Protein 2%, Carbohydrate 98%
Totals and Percent Daily Values (2000 calories): Fat 0g, Saturated Fat 0g, Cholesterol 0mg, Sodium 148mg, Total Carbohydrate 15g, Dietary Fiber 0g, Protein 0g, Vitamin A 19 units, Vitamin C 2 units, Calcium 0 units, Iron 0 units
